Praise the Lord, my soul
							
																								
								1
								
									 Hallelujah! (a)  Praise the LORD, O my soul.
								
							 
																								
								2
								
									 I will praise the LORD all my life; I will sing praises to my God while I have my being.
								
							 
																								
								3
								
									 Put not your trust in princes, in mortal man, who cannot save.
								
							 
																								
								4
								
									When his spirit departs, he returns to the ground; on that very day his plans perish.
								
							 
																								
								5
								
									 Blessed is he whose help is the God of Jacob, whose hope is in the LORD his God,
								
							 
																								
								6
								
									the Maker of heaven and earth, the sea, and everything in them. He remains faithful forever.
								
							 
																								
								7
								
									He executes justice for the oppressed  and gives food to the hungry. The LORD sets the prisoners free,
								
							 
																								
								8
								
									the LORD opens the eyes of the blind, the LORD lifts those who are weighed down, the LORD loves the righteous.
								
							 
																								
								9
								
									The LORD protects foreigners; He sustains the fatherless and the widow, but the ways of the wicked He frustrates.
								
							 
																								
								10
								
									 The LORD reigns forever, your God, O Zion, for all generations. Hallelujah!
